edits
[iotcloud.git] / version2 / src / C / Abort.h
index ad54c4fd09221e545934a9ab0d76840c3c0f5e91..84b8c41d0ade937c677b401f7382f297484044b8 100644 (file)
@@ -12,13 +12,13 @@ private:
        int64_t transactionMachineId;
        int64_t transactionArbitrator;
        int64_t arbitratorLocalSequenceNumber;
-       Pair<int64_t, int64_t> *abortId;
+       Pair<int64_t, int64_t> abortId;
 
 public:
        Abort(Slot *slot, int64_t _transactionClientLocalSequenceNumber, int64_t _transactionSequenceNumber,  int64_t _transactionMachineId, int64_t _transactionArbitrator, int64_t _arbitratorLocalSequenceNumber);
        Abort(Slot *slot, int64_t _transactionClientLocalSequenceNumber, int64_t _transactionSequenceNumber, int64_t _sequenceNumber,  int64_t _transactionMachineId, int64_t _transactionArbitrator, int64_t _arbitratorLocalSequenceNumber);
 
-       Pair<int64_t, int64_t> *getAbortId() {return abortId;}
+       Pair<int64_t, int64_t> getAbortId() {return abortId;}
 
        int64_t getTransactionMachineId() { return transactionMachineId; }
        int64_t getTransactionSequenceNumber()  { return transactionSequenceNumber; }
@@ -35,5 +35,5 @@ public:
        Entry *getCopy(Slot *s) { return new Abort(s, transactionClientLocalSequenceNumber, transactionSequenceNumber, sequenceNumber, transactionMachineId, transactionArbitrator, arbitratorLocalSequenceNumber); }
 };
 
-Entry *Abortdecode(Slot *slot, ByteBuffer *bb);
+Entry *Abort_decode(Slot *slot, ByteBuffer *bb);
 #endif